Profile
An exceptionally large, secure, and well-maintained dog park set in scenic countryside, featuring multiple fields to book with plenty of space for dogs to run off-lead and explore. The park offers a wide variety of enrichment options including separate agility areas, sensory gardens, shaded seating, covered shelters, picnic tables, bins, poo bag dispensers, water stations, and even a dog shower. The park is welcoming to dogs with various needs, including those with poor recall or dog reactivity, as bookings are for exclusive use. The staff are frequently praised for their warm welcomes and thorough introductions for first time visitors. Continuous improvements are noted, with a fenced-off water/pond area and sand pits in development. The facility is appreciated for its tranquility, beautiful views, and thoughtful design catering to both dogs and owners.
Field Feature Notes:
– Secured: Described as fully enclosed, very secure, double gates, six-foot fencing, and safety precautions in place. Suitable for dogs with escape tendencies or reactivity.
– Seating: Multiple mentions of plenty of seating, picnic benches, covered seating, and shelters for human comfort in all weather.
– Toilets: Toilets by the entrance are specifically mentioned; described as clean and well-kept.
– Toilet Bags: Poo bag dispensers are specifically mentioned and are easily available throughout the park.
– Bins: Bins for waste are numerous and conveniently located.
– Shaded Areas: Covered seating, shelters, trees, and shaded areas are mentioned several times as features for both weather protection and shade.
– Drinking Water: Multiple dedicated water stations and fresh water taps are available throughout the park.
– Water Play Area: A fenced-off pond is under construction or planned; not yet consistently available but imminent. Some mention of muddy/wet areas and a shower, but not a completed swimming area for dogs at time of most comments.
– Agility Equipment: Multiple agility areas with ramps, hurdles, tunnels, and other enrichment features are present and frequently praised.
– Park Size: Park described as ‘huge’, ‘massive’, ‘over six acres’, ‘acres for them to run’, with multiple fields—it is one of the largest around.
– Cost: Booking is required (exclusive use); some mention that regular use may be expensive, but generally considered good value for the facilities and size.
